Encodeur et décodeur d'entités HTML
Collez du texte pour échapper les caractères qui ont une signification particulière en HTML, ou collez du balisage encodé pour décoder les entités. L'outil gère les entités nommées et numériques et fonctionne entièrement dans votre navigateur.
Encoder ou décoder
Ouvrez l'outil dans le mode dont vous avez besoin — chacun a sa propre page :
Comment encoder ou décoder des entités HTML
- Choisissez Encoder (texte → entités) ou Décoder (entités → texte).
- Collez votre texte ; le résultat se met à jour au fur et à mesure que vous tapez.
- Copiez le résultat — activez « encoder tout le non-ASCII » si vous en avez besoin.
À propos des entités HTML
Certains caractères ne peuvent pas apparaître littéralement en HTML : une esperluette commence une entité, et les chevrons ouvrent et ferment les balises. Les remplacer par des entités — &, <, > — permet au texte de s'afficher tel quel au lieu de casser le balisage. Les guillemets sont également échappés lorsque le texte se trouve à l'intérieur d'un attribut.
L'encodage couvre ici les caractères réservés par défaut, avec une option pour échapper chaque caractère non-ASCII sous forme d'entité numérique pour une portabilité maximale. Le décodage utilise l'analyseur du navigateur, il comprend donc l'ensemble complet des entités nommées. Tout fonctionne localement — instantané, privé et gratuit.
Questions fréquentes
Que sont les entités HTML ?
Les entités HTML sont des codes comme &, < et © qui représentent des caractères réservés en HTML (comme &, < et >) ou difficiles à saisir, afin qu'ils s'affichent correctement au lieu d'être interprétés comme du balisage.
Quels caractères l'encodage échappe-t-il ?
Par défaut, il échappe les cinq caractères réservés : & < > " et l'apostrophe. Activez « encoder tout le non-ASCII » pour convertir également les lettres accentuées, les symboles et les emoji en entités numériques.
Le décodage prend-il en charge les entités nommées ?
Oui. Le décodage utilise le propre analyseur HTML du navigateur, donc l'ensemble complet des entités nommées (comme © et ) et des entités numériques (© ou ©) est pris en charge.
Mon texte est-il envoyé ?
Non. L'encodage et le décodage se déroulent entièrement dans votre navigateur, donc tout ce que vous collez ne quitte jamais votre appareil.